80% of land in the UK is used for farming, and it has shaped our landscapes over thousands of years.

Traditionally farmland has provided many different types of habitats and has supported a wealth of different species. However over the years farming has become more intense, as a result Farmland Wildlife has depleted.

People are realising just how important it is to ensure that there is a place on our farms for habitats and wildlife.
conservation
Here at Upton we are working to ensure that the species and habitats traditionally associated with farmland are able to thrive alongside the crops and livestock. The final goal is delivering an effective balance and producing food for us and wildlife. As a result all of the crops at Upton are grown in accordance with Conservation Grade Protocols.
